Saw the new episode today, titled Relicanth, or Can It? (I think that's right...)
Anyway, Ash and friends arrive at one of the islands and meet up with Dan, an adept tresure diver (with a real ego problem). They take a ride in his and his wife's sub, and of course Team Rocket (who's Magikarp Sub finally comes back ^.^) hears about some giant treasure that Dan mentions and take pursuit. Ash, Dan, and the rest find the sunken ship with the tresure, and the ship is home to a group of Relicanth. TR tries to steal the treasure (not Pikachu for once), but fail, when they all finally surface and Pikachu and May's Bulbasaur pwn TR, and that's pretty much it.

Well, they have to do that in order to flesh out the series.
If the characters spontainiously appeared at the next town each episode, each season would only be about 12 episodes long.
There are 4 types of pokemon episodes-
Catch em/ evolve em- These involve a character getting a new pokemon or one of their old ones evolving.
Gym battles- self explanitory, The main reason for the series.
Fillers- Ash and co meet someone in trouble, Ash and co attempt to help said person. Team rocket trys to steal pikachu and/or something else. Team rocket blast off. By doing so Ash and co have helped irrelivant character. Roll credits.
Emotinals- An episode designed to pluck the heart strings and deepen the characters personality, like 'Pikachu's goodbye" and 'True blue swablu'.
Unfortunatley, most episodes fall into the third category, making a big waste of time.
